We'd all love to take a break from shelling out money on gas, not to mention new tires. Guess what? Basic maintenance helps — the proper tire pressure can improve your gas mileage by up to 3%.

Tires should maintain a certain PSI (pressure per square inch), which is usually marked on the side of the tire or on the side of the door. This is not just a throwaway number — the measurement is important for safety, fuel efficiency and much more, so you want a correct reading.
